MySQL是一种常用的数据库管理系统,但是有时候由于各种原因我们可能会忘记自己的MySQL密码,这时候就需要找到一种方法来解决这个问题。下面我们就来介绍一下如何查看MySQL的密码,以及如何解决MySQL密码丢失的问题。
一、如何查看MySQL的密码
1.通过MySQL配置文件查看
yf中可以找到MySQL的密码信息。具体方法如下:
打开终端,输入以下命令进入MySQL配置文件所在的目录:
ysql/
yf文件:
anoyf
ysqld]段落,然后在这个段落中查找password这个关键字。如果找到了这个关键字,那么它后面的就是MySQL的密码了。
2.通过MySQL命令行查看
在MySQL命令行中也可以查看MySQL的密码信息。具体方法如下:
打开终端,输入以下命令进入MySQL命令行:
ysql -u root -p
然后输入MySQL的root账号密码,进入MySQL命令行后输入以下命令:
ticationgysql.user;
ticationg就是MySQL的密码。
二、如何解决MySQL密码丢失的问题
如果你忘记了MySQL的密码,那么可以通过以下方法来解决这个问题。
1.通过MySQL配置文件修改密码
打开终端,输入以下命令进入MySQL配置文件所在的目录:
ysql/
yf文件:
anoyf
ysqld]段落,然后在这个段落中加入以下两行代码:
t-tablesetworking
然后保存文件并退出。
接着重启MySQL服务:
ysql restart
然后再次打开终端,输入以下命令进入MySQL命令行:
ysql -u root
这时候就可以直接进入MySQL命令行了,然后输入以下命令修改密码:
ysqlticationgew_password') WHERE User='root';
ew_password是你要设置的新密码。
yf文件,删除之前加入的两行代码,然后保存文件并退出。
最后再次重启MySQL服务:
ysql restart
2.通过MySQL命令行修改密码
如果你还记得MySQL的root账号密码,那么可以通过以下方法来修改MySQL的密码。
打开终端,输入以下命令进入MySQL命令行:
ysql -u root -p
然后输入MySQL的root账号密码,进入MySQL命令行后输入以下命令:
ew_password';
ew_password是你要设置的新密码。
修改完密码后,退出MySQL命令行。
以上就是如何查看MySQL的密码以及如何解决MySQL密码丢失的问题的方法。在操作过程中一定要注意备份数据,以免造成数据丢失。